Not flat enough for an induction stovetop
This cookware set is very beautiful! We are so sad to have to return it. I purchased this because I got a new induction cooktop and needed the appropriate type of pans and these were SO pretty and priced well! A month after I had my stove, I had a problem with the control panel and had the appliance tech come to service the oven. While he was there I expressed my disappointment that it took forever to boil water on a stovetop that was marketed to take mere seconds. He told me to get my iron frying pan and my member's mark frying pan and put them both on the stove at the same time to test the stove out. the iron pan boiled in 3 seconds!!!! the members mark pan took 10 minutes :( we switched burners to make sure and it was the same result. The tech turned the pots over and used a level on the bottom of the pan set and with each pot only one ring of dots was level and touching the glass top. If the pots are not flat and able to touch the stove surface then they can't work. I love these pots and really hate to return them. They would work well on a gas stove (maybe an electric?) but not an induction stovetop.
We are sorry to hear your experience, PJ. Iron cookware naturally heats faster on an induction cooktop compared to aluminum cookware. In fact, aluminum material is not compatible with induction cooktops. To enable the induction function, we add an magnetic stainless steel base on our modern set through impact bonding technique. Induction cooktops heat the aluminum cookware through electromagnetic induction, and it doesn’t require the cookware to make perfectly even contact with the surface. A slightly concave bottom of the cookware is specially designed to ensure stability on the induction cooktop after heating. We are sorry for your experience with the cookware, Mercy. Here are some tips to help you protect this set. 1) Cook using LOW to MEDIUM HEAT ONLY. The leading cause of material to lose non-stick nature is the use of very high temperature. It could be fatal and damages the ceramic layers causing the material to lose its non-stick nature. 2) Always cool down to room temperature before washing, and hand washing is recommended.3) Due to highly efficient heating, the food juice may be carbonized on the ceramic cooking surfaces at high temperatures, forming tiny black dirt marks. To help remove staining, 1. Pour vinegar onto a scrubbing pad and scrub the stain. Vinegar is effective in removing most stains. 2. Make a paste of 1 tablespoon baking soda and 2 tablespoons vinegar in a pan and fill with warm water. Let the pan sit for a few hours, then scrub the stains.
